A significant weather alert has been issued for California, Nevada, and Arizona as a colossal storm barrels toward the West Coast, sparking fears of flash flooding, heavy snowfall, and fierce winds.

Following a recent snowstorm that blanketed California to Utah with 10 to 13 inches of snow, a larger and more menacing storm is poised to strike Southern California. Forecasters warn of imminent flash flooding, powerful gusts, and substantial snowfall.

The storm, captured in ominous satellite images, is expected to unleash its fury late Friday morning, targeting the San Francisco Bay area before advancing southward to Santa Barbara and Los Angeles by evening, persisting through Saturday morning.

According to meteorologists, Southern California, including San Diego, will face relentless on-and-off showers and thunderstorms throughout Saturday and Sunday. Rainfall predictions range from 1 to 3 inches across most regions, with the foothills of Southern California bracing for a potential deluge of up to 6 inches. Authorities warn of the heightened risk of flash floods, mudslides, rockslides, and debris flow in affected areas.

In the mountainous regions spanning from the Sierras to Southern California, staggering snow accumulations of 1 to 3 feet are anticipated, exacerbating travel disruptions and avalanche hazards.

As the weekend progresses, the storm's impact is expected to extend into the Rockies, where heavy snowfall of 1 to 2 feet is projected by Sunday. Meanwhile, on Monday, the storm system is forecasted to traverse the Heartland, unleashing severe weather conditions from Texas to Illinois. The primary threats include destructive winds, hailstorms, and the potential formation of tornadoes.

By Tuesday, the storm's reach will extend into the Ohio River Valley and the Mid-South, spanning from Alabama to Ohio, with damaging winds, torrential rainfall, and isolated tornadoes posing significant risks to affected communities.
